About this House

Warm and inviting from the moment you arrive, this home offers the perfect blend of comfort, style, and outdoor living. Tucked away on a quiet cul-de-sac with no HOA and central A/C for year-round comfort, you'll enjoy added privacy and freedom. Rich wood flooring flows throughout the home, complemented by vaulted and coved ceilings, distinctive architectural details, and abundant natural light. The beautifully remodeled white kitchen features stainless steel appliances, matte black granite countertops, subway tile backsplash, and generous workspace overlooking the great room with a cozy gas fireplace. The spacious primary suite offers a peaceful retreat with a walk-in closet and private five-piece ensuite. Two additional bedrooms provide comfortable, flexible living spaces complemented by an updated main bathroom with modern finishes. Step outside to your own backyard oasis featuring an expansive covered Trex deck with a warm tongue-and-groove wood ceiling, perfect for year-round entertaining. Enjoy mature landscaping, garden beds, fruit trees, established grapevines, a firepit, storage shed, and a fully fenced backyard designed for relaxing and enjoying the outdoors. Completing this exceptional home is an encapsulated crawlspace, adding lasting value and reflecting the pride of ownership found throughout.
